Until Haile Selassie I was deposed in 1974, their rule was supposed to have been continuous but for two periods, the reign of the Zagwe dynasty (12th-13th century) and the reign of Tewodros II (1855-68). He is supposed to have had a replica made of the Ark for them to take with them, but the son of Zadok the High Priest secretly switched the replica with the real Ark, and brought it into Ethiopia where it is said to remain to this day in the ancient town of Axum. In his article Where Is the Land of ShebaArabia or Africa? published in the September/October 2016 issue of Biblical Archaeology Review, Bar Kribus investigates the location of the land of Sheba and looks at the figure of the Queen of Shebaboth in the Bible and in a text called the Kebra Nagast. The arms are composed of an Imperial Throne flanked by two angels, one holding a sword and a pair of scales, the other holding the Imperial sceptre. Attributed to Is'haq Nebur -Id, the work is divided into 117 chapters, described by Ethiopian scholar Edward Ullendorff as "a gigantic conflation of legendary cycles." The official Imperial Dynastic motto was "Ityopia tabetsih edewiha habe Igziabiher" (Ethiopia stretches her hands unto God), a quote from the Psalm 68:31.
